Libricide
The Regime-Sponsored Destruction of Books and Libraries in the Twentieth Century
Rebecca Knuth
Language Arts & Disciplines / Publishers & Publishing Industry
Readers will learn why some people—even those not subject to authoritarian regimes—consider the destruction of books a positive process. Knuth promotes understanding of the reasons behind extremism and patterns of cultural terrorism, and concludes that what is at stake with libricide is nothing less than the preservation and continuation of the common cultural heritage of the world. Anyone committed to freedom of expression and humanistic values will embrace this passionate and valuable book.
